Edmund Sabanegh is a scholar working on Reproductive Medicine,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ism. According to data from OpenAlex, Edmund Sabanegh has authored 97 papers receiving a total of 3.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 77 papers in Reproductive Medicine, 45 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 15 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ism. Recurrent topics in Edmund Sabanegh’s work include Sperm and Testicular Function (73 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(43 papers) and Reproductive Health and Technologies (24 papers). Edmund Sabanegh is often cited by papers focused on Sperm and Testicular Function (73 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(43 papers) and Reproductive Health and Technologies (24 papers). Edmund Sabanegh collaborates with scholars based in United States, India and South Africa. Edmund Sabanegh's co-authors include Ashok Agarwal, Rakesh Sharma, Belinda Willard, Reda Z. Mahfouz and Banu Gopalan and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Urology, Fertility and Sterility and Human Reproduction Update.
